Transaction 1698da80bc4cb91a21006fc0846f90e960a51abba982c919cf43c7224be5d895

2 Input
2 Outputs
  • 1698da80bc4cb91a21006fc0846f90e960a51abba982c919cf43c7224be5d895:0
  • value  348531
    address  15fvrtGVT1vUqdwJ86QFFXAJXQYWoqjT7P
  • 1698da80bc4cb91a21006fc0846f90e960a51abba982c919cf43c7224be5d895:1
  • value  15894313
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n